The Tulsa Hurricane defeated the Jackson State Tigers in the first round of the Las Vegas Classic 92-39. Tulsa played tough defense all night long and held the Tigers to 19 points in the first half while scoring 43. Ben Uzoh was all over the floor getting 22 points, 8 rebounds, 8 assists, and 2 steals. Justin Hurtt made three 3-pointers and scored 14 points in the game. Jackson State (0-8) continues to struggle without the services of Grant Maxey, who is out with an ankle injury. Tyrone Hanson was the only Jackson State player to score in double digits, and he finished with 14 points.
